Lawyers Hit Out At Chinese Police Amid Rumors of Detainee Abuse

Zhao Wei

Detained legal assistant Zhao Wei, shown in an undated photo from the rights website Weiquanwang. Weiquanwang

Amid unconfirmed reports that she has been sexually abused in detention, authorities are preventing a defense attorney from seeing a legal assistant jailed during last year’s nationwide police operation targeting human rights lawyers, RFA has learned. Continue reading

China: Subversion Charges Target Lawyers

Arrests Reflect Xi Jinping’s Broader Repression of Rights Activism

(New York) – The Chinese authorities’ formal arrest of at least 11 human rights lawyers, legal assistants, and activists on political subversion charges is an unprecedented and grave escalation of attacks on rights defenders in China, Human Rights Watch said today. Authorities should immediately drop the charges and release the 11, as well as other lawyers and human rights advocates in custody for political reasons. Continue reading
